Output 22deb542aa5a739ba1986b7c24a8113d0b6d59eca681b349a7b810bcf7cfeecd:4

value
2741223361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ab44108f35f4c685645ee70b2196dd1519fee8c8 OP_EQUAL
address
3HJb1ZfXaQkRCy1U1uJXQ26zD2XdtGNoLE
transaction
22deb542aa5a739ba1986b7c24a8113d0b6d59eca681b349a7b810bcf7cfeecd
spent
true